[Bf-extensions-cvs] [3b7dd920] master: BugFix Overrides: Collection names
Eugenio Pignataro
noreply at git.blender.org
Thu May 14 17:10:45 CEST 2020
Commit: 3b7dd92024ac0ac2b58b3ef4e5cf7daee6dfdefb
Author: Eugenio Pignataro
Date: Thu May 14 12:10:34 2020 -0300
Branches: master
https://developer.blender.org/rBA3b7dd92024ac0ac2b58b3ef4e5cf7daee6dfdefb
BugFix Overrides: Collection names
===================================================================
M oscurart_tools/render/material_overrides.py
===================================================================
diff --git a/oscurart_tools/render/material_overrides.py b/oscurart_tools/render/material_overrides.py
index 4c3e936e..06a3a200 100644
--- a/oscurart_tools/render/material_overrides.py
+++ b/oscurart_tools/render/material_overrides.py
@@ -13,10 +13,7 @@ def ApplyOverrides(dummy):
for override in bpy.context.scene.ovlist:
# set collections clean name
- if override.grooverride.endswith("]"):
- collClean = override.grooverride[3:].split("[")[0][:-1]
- else:
- collClean = override.grooverride[3:]
+ collClean = override.grooverride
for ob in bpy.data.collections[collClean].all_objects:
if ob.type == "MESH":
@@ -33,15 +30,9 @@ def ApplyOverrides(dummy):
for override in bpy.context.scene.ovlist:
# set collections clean name
- if override.grooverride.endswith("]"):
- collClean = override.grooverride[3:].split("[")[0][:-1]
- else:
- collClean = override.grooverride[3:]
+ collClean = override.grooverride
# set material clean name
- if override.matoverride.endswith("]"):
- matClean = override.matoverride[3:].split("[")[0][:-1]
- else:
- matClean = override.matoverride[3:]
+ matClean = override.matoverride
for ob in bpy.data.collections[collClean].all_objects:
More information about the Bf-extensions-cvs
mailing list